USING NEWTON'S LAW OF COOLING...You place a cup of 210oF coffee on a table in a room that is 68oF, and 10 minutes later, it is 200oF. Approximately how long will it be before the coffee is 180oF?

by using Newtonian law of cooling.... T(t) = Ts + (To - Ts)e^-kt ... 180 = 68 + (210 - 68)*e^(-.0073025*t).... solve now for "t"... must use calculator, so that calculation is free from errors.... @jackyjacksx
